Selective showing of taskbar buttons for forms

I've been using the following to put a separate button on the taskbar
for each form in my application:

  SetWindowLong(Handle, GWL_EXSTYLE, GetWindowLong(Handle,

The problem with this method is that every modal dialog that pops up
in the app also puts a button on the taskbar, which I don't want to
happen. How can I prevent the button on these forms?